  <abstract type="Summary">Demyelination and neurodegeneration are key features of FAHN, a rare disorder caused by FA2H gene mutations. These mutations reduce enzymatic activity, leading to myelin instability, demyelination, and axonal degradation. In this study, we derived neurons and oligodendrocytes from FAHN patient hiPSCs and cocultured them to examine myelination in vitro. FA2H-deficient cells showed impaired myelination, with lower myelin protein levels and altered axonal structures, including shorter internodes and irregular Ranvier nodes.&lt;eng&gt;</abstract>
  <abstract type="Summary">Demyelinisierung und Neurodegeneration sind Hauptmerkmale von FAHN, einer seltenen Erkrankung durch FA2H-Mutationen. Diese verringern die Enzymaktivität, was Myelinstabilität, Demyelinisierung und axonalen Abbau verursacht. Wir leiteten Neuronen und Oligodendrozyten aus hiPSCs eines FAHN-Patienten ab und kokultivierten sie, um die Myelinisierung in vitro zu untersuchen. FA2H-defiziente Zellen zeigten reduzierte Myelinproteine, verkürzte Internodien und unregelmäßige Ranvier-Schnürringe.&lt;ger&gt;</abstract>
